“The White Lotus” is almost back for its third season, which will see a new cast and one familiar face head to the Thailand location of the White Lotus resort.

After Jennifer Coolidge’s Tanya returned for Season 2 to face a deadly fate, creator Mike White is bringing back Season 1 star Natasha Rothwell, who played Belinda at the Maui White Lotus, to the third installment of the HBO drama series.

Beyond Rothwell, “The White Lotus” will welcome a new, star-studded cast for Season 3, including Carrie Coon, Walton Goggins, Parker Posey, Leslie Bibb and Michelle Monaghan, among others. Here’s everything we know about the third season so far.

It Premieres on HBO in February

Season 3 will debut its first episode Sunday, Feb. 16 on HBO and Max. Like previous seasons, “The White Lotus” Season 3 will release weekly.

It Takes Place in Thailand

While Season 1 started off in Hawaii and Season 2 took audiences to Sicily, Season 3 will take us to Thailand, following a group of guests and staffers at the White Lotus hotel in Thailand. Season 3 began production in and around Koh Samui, Phuket, and Bangkok in February 2024, according to HBO.

Natasha Rothwell’s Belinda Comes Back

After going a whole season without seeing Rothwell, Season 3 will bring back Rothwell as Belinda after introducing her as the spa manager in the White Lotus resort on Maui in Season 1. The teaser explains that Belinda is on an “exchange program” to the Thailand location of the resort, where she will work and learn alongside the Thailand spa.

There’s a New All-Star Cast

Like its previous two seasons, the third installment will follow several groups of White Lotus vacationers. Those include a family played by Jason Isaacs, Parker Posey, Patrick Schwarzenegger, Sarah Catherine Hook and Sam Nivola; a group of longtime friends reconnecting on a girls trip played by Carrie Coon, Michelle Monaghan and Leslie Bibb; and a couple played by Walton Goggins and Aimee Lou Wood.

As can be expected of any “White Lotus” season, there will be plenty of tension from each group, which was hinted to in the teaser after Wood’s Chelsea tells Goggins’ Rick he needs “stress management meditation,” and Coon’s Laurie gossips to Bibb’s Kate that Monaghan’s Jaclyn “lives off male attention.”

The hotel staff will be played by Morgana O’Reilly, Arnas Fedaravičius, Christian Friedel, Dom Hetrakul, Tayme Thapthimthong and Lalisa Manobal, also known as Lisa from famed K-pop girl group, BLACKPINK. Additional cast includes Lek Patravadi, Nicholas Duvernay, Arnas Fedaravičius, Christian Friedel, Scott Glenn, Dom Hetrakul, Julian Kostov, Charlotte Le Bon, Morgana O’Reilly and Shalini Peiris.

The Big Theme Will Be Death and Spirituality

In a behind-the-scenes breakdown of the Season 2 finale, creator and showrunner Mike White teased that Season 3 would be all about death.

“The first season kind of highlighted money, and then the second season is sex, and I think the third season would be maybe a kind of satirical and funny look at death and Eastern religion and spirituality, and it feels like it could be a rich tapestry to do another round at White Lotus,” he said.

It Might Tie Up Loose Ends From the Season 2 Finale

White said in the same video that the conspiracy around Greg’s murder plot against Tanya could return in Season 3.

“I think as far as what happens to Greg and the conspiracy of Tanya’s death, it’s possible that I think Portia is scared enough to just leave it alone but the fact that all of those guys die on the boat feels like there’s gotta be somebody who’s gonna track it back down to Greg,” he said, adding “you’ll have to wait to find out what happens.”

With Belinda (Rothwell) — who Tanya took a particular liking to in Season 1 before Tanya starting dating Greg (Jon Gries) — could we see Portia (Haley Lu Richardson) and/or Greg return in Season 3?

Mike White Will Be Back

The creator will return as showrunner, write and director for Season 3. The “Enlightened” creator has thus far written and directed every single episode of “The White Lotus” himself, so it’s safe to say the show would not be the same without him.

“There’s no place I’d rather work than HBO and there’s no people I’d rather partner with than Casey Bloys, Francesca Orsi, Nora Skinner and their incredible team,” White said when the show was renewed for a third season. “I feel so lucky to get this opportunity again and am excited to reunite with my amazingly talented collaborators on ‘The White Lotus.’”

Season 4 Is Already in the Works

Max boss Casey Bloys told reporters in November 2024 that White has already shared ideas for a fourth season. “Mike, obviously — if he wants to move forward and do the four seasons — he will do the fourth season,” Bloys said.
